Negative Reinforcing
A behavior modification process where the removal of an unpleasant stimulus strengthens a behavior.
Negative Reinforcer
A stimulus that, when removed after a behavior occurs, increases the likelihood of that behavior being repeated.
Reduction In Tension
A process or action that decreases stress or anxiety levels in individuals or groups.
Oral Needs
Psychological or physical requirements for satisfaction received through the mouth, such as eating, drinking, or the need for verbal expression.
